virtue

vir·tue [ vúrchoo ] (plural vir·tues)


noun 
Definition:
 
1. goodness: the quality of being morally good or righteous
a paragon of virtue

2. good quality: a quality that is morally good
Patience is a virtue.

3. admirable quality: a quality that is good or admirable, but not necessarily in terms of morality

4. christianity cardinal or theological morality: a cardinal virtue, e.g. justice or moderation, or theological virtue, e.g. hope or charity

5. chastity: the moral quality of being chaste, especially in a woman

6. worth: the worth, advantage, or beneficial quality of something
knew the virtue of thrift

7. christianity angel of fifth highest order: in the traditional Christian hierarchy, an angel of the fifth of the nine orders of angels

[12th century. Via Old French vertu< Latin virtus "manliness, excellence, worth" < vir "man, husband"]

vir·tue·less adjective

by virtue of because of, through the power of, or by the authority of something

make a virtue of necessity to do something with good grace, when you are obligated to do it anyway
